Price Factors
The pricing of iron wire mesh can fluctuate based on several factors. One of the primary determinants is the cost of raw materials. As with many metal products, prices can be affected by the global supply and demand dynamics for steel and iron. In recent years, rising production costs in key manufacturing regions have influenced the final pricing of iron wire mesh. Additionally, variations in mesh sizes, wire gauges, and finishes (such as galvanized or PVC-coated) can lead to differences in pricing, as specialized products often command a premium.
Regional Variations
While examining exporters, it is important to note that prices for iron wire mesh can vary significantly based on the region. Countries with a well-established manufacturing base, such as China, India, and Turkey, often dominate the export market. These countries benefit from lower production costs, advanced manufacturing technologies, and efficient supply chains. As a result, they can offer competitive pricing that appeals to international buyers.
Conversely, regions with higher production costs may have limited export capabilities or will often charge higher prices due to increased overhead. Therefore, businesses looking to import iron wire mesh should consider not only the price but also the supplier's location, quality standards, and reliability.
Key Exporters
In the global market, several prominent exporters have built a reputation for quality and reliability. For instance, Chinese manufacturers are known for their vast output and diverse product range, catering to both low-cost and premium market segments. On the other hand, European exporters often emphasize higher quality standards and certification compliance, targeting clients who prioritize quality over cost.
